The systems in an occupational health clinic answer to two customers at once. A DOT physical is not complete until it is certified to the FMCSA National Registry, a pre-employment drug screen is only as strong as its electronic chain of custody in eScreen or FormFox, and an employer’s HR team quietly measures your clinic by how quickly a work-status report reaches their inbox. When any of those systems slips, both the worker and the employer feel it the same day.

The technology footprint is wider than most medical offices carry. Occupational medicine platforms like Net Health and SYSTOC track employer-specific protocols alongside clinical charts. Audiometric booths from Benson or Tremetrics, NIOSH-grade spirometers, vision screeners, and PortaCount respirator fit testers all generate data that must land in the right record under the right employer account. Add breath alcohol devices, OSHA recordkeeping, and workers’ comp billing, and a mid-sized clinic runs more integrations than many hospitals.

healthcare IT challenges occupational health clinics face

The first challenge in occupational health is device sprawl. Audiometers, spirometers, vision screeners, EKGs, and PortaCount fit testers each speak their own software dialect, and their results must flow into Net Health, SYSTOC, or your EHR under the correct employer protocol. Medical IT Company interfaces and maintains every one of those instruments, tests them after updates, and keeps calibration-critical workstations stable so a surveillance exam never has to be repeated because a driver failed.

Drug and alcohol testing is the second, because chain of custody is unforgiving. Electronic CCFs through eScreen or FormFox, label printers at the collection point, and breath alcohol devices must work on every specimen, and DOT exams add National Registry submissions with their own credentialing. We monitor these endpoints continuously and fix failures fast, protecting the defensibility of every result you release.

Third is employer reporting at scale. A clinic may serve a hundred companies, each with its own panel, portal, and turnaround expectation. We automate secure result delivery and work-status reporting, harden the email and portal paths those reports travel, and make onboarding a new employer account an IT non-event. When a plant manager calls about a batch of pre-hire physicals, your staff answers with the report on screen instead of a promise to look into it.

Finally, occupational health straddles HIPAA, OSHA recordkeeping, and state workers’ comp rules simultaneously, with records that may need to survive for thirty years. We build encrypted, tested backup and retention systems, enforce strict access controls between employer and clinical data, and document the whole program so audits from any direction find you ready.
